The distance from Can Gio to the Cu Chi district is 135 km, the journey is expected to take approximately 3 hours. You will have a relaxed transition between the natural landscapes of Can Gio and the historical site of the Cu Chi Tunnels.
The Cu Chi Tunnels have a extensive space more than 250 kilometers, was used by Viet Cong militias as a spot to hide, live, and get supplies. It was an important part of their guerrilla warfare tactics during the war.
Currently, The government has renovated the tunnels to make them suitable for tourism. However, when you experience the inside of the tunnels, you can feel the soldiers' lives that are tough lives. This tour offers you a display of camouflage entrance methods and traps made from natural materials in the jungle that were used to defend against enemy forces.

Seasons Throughout the Year
Can Gio & Cu Chi Tunnels experience two main seasons: the wet season and the dry season. The wet season, from May to October, is characterized by heavy rains, which can make travel to certain areas more challenging but also more lush and green. The dry season, from November to April, features warmer weather and less precipitation, making it easier to explore outdoor attractions.
Best Time to Visit
The best time to visit Cangio Monkey Island and the Cu Chi Tunnels is during the dry season, from December to April. This period offers comfortable weather conditions for exploring the outdoors, with lower chances of rain interrupting your plans. The cooler temperatures in these months make it ideal for walking tours and outdoor activities.
We recommended to avoid visiting both Cần Giờ and Củ Chi during the peak of the rainy season, from June to August. The reason is the increased likelihood of heavy rains, especially in the Cần Giờ mangrove areas, and muddy conditions in the Củ Chi tunnels.
The areas surrounding Cangio Monkey Island and the Cu Chi Tunnels offer a variety of local dishes worth trying. Seafood is a highlight in Cangio, with dishes like grilled fish, shrimp, and crab fresh from the mangrove waters.
In the Cu Chi region, traditional Vietnamese fare, such as pho (noodle soup), banh mi (sandwiches), and goi cuon (spring rolls), provides a taste of the local culinary landscape. Don’t miss the chance to try local specialties like banh xeo (Vietnamese pancakes) and fresh coconut water to cool off.

Travel Tips
Comfortable Attire: Opt for light and breathable clothing due to the humid and warm climate. Long sleeves and pants can protect you from mosquitoes in Can Gio’s mangroves and the underbrush around Củ Chi.
Sturdy Footwear: Closed-toe shoes or hiking boots are recommended for navigating the terrain, especially when exploring the Củ Chi tunnels or walking through the mangroves.
Sun Protection: Bring hats, sunglasses, and sunscreen to shield yourself from the sun’s rays during outdoor activities.
Insect Repellent: Essential for both locations to avoid mosquito and insect bites.
